Custom API Integration with HubSpot: Rate Limit Tips

By
The Reform Team
Use AI to summarize text or ask questions

When building a custom API integration with HubSpot, managing rate limits is key to avoiding disruptions. HubSpot enforces burst limits (requests per 10 seconds) and daily quotas (rolling 24-hour request caps). Exceeding these limits results in HTTP 429 errors, which can halt workflows and impact app reliability. Here’s how to handle them effectively:

  • Understand Limits: Free/Starter plans allow 100 requests per 10 seconds and 250,000 daily. Enterprise plans offer up to 190 requests per 10 seconds and 1,000,000 daily, with add-ons available for more capacity.
  • Optimize API Calls: Use batching to group up to 100 records per request and caching to reduce duplicate calls. These steps can cut API usage by up to 75%.
  • Retry Logic: Implement exponential backoff with random delays to manage 429 errors and prevent cascading failures.
  • Switch to Webhooks: Replace polling with webhooks to reduce API calls. Workflow-triggered webhooks don’t count toward rate limits for certain plans.
  • Monitor Usage: Use HubSpot’s API call usage dashboard and response headers like X-HubSpot-RateLimit-Daily-Remaining for real-time tracking.

These strategies ensure smooth integrations while staying within HubSpot’s rate constraints. For growing needs, consider upgrading plans or adding API Limit Increase packs.

What Are HubSpot API Rate Limits?

HubSpot imposes two main types of API rate limits to ensure platform stability and fair usage: Burst Limits and Daily Quotas.

  • Burst Limits control how many API requests you can send in a 10-second window.
  • Daily Quotas cap the total number of API requests allowed over a rolling 24-hour period.

While burst limits are applied per app, daily quotas are shared across all private apps within a single HubSpot account. If you exceed either limit, HubSpot will respond with an HTTP 429 "Too Many Requests" error, temporarily blocking further API calls until the limit resets.

Product Tier Burst Limit (Per 10 Seconds) Daily Limit (Per Account)
Free & Starter 100 per app 250,000
Professional 190 per app 625,000
Enterprise 190 per app 1,000,000
With API Limit Increase 250 per app Base + 1,000,000 per increase

HubSpot resets daily quotas at midnight based on your account's time zone. If your integration requires more capacity, HubSpot offers an API Limit Increase add-on, which raises the burst limit to 250 requests per 10 seconds and adds 1,000,000 requests to your daily quota. You can purchase up to two increases.

For publicly distributed OAuth apps listed in the HubSpot Marketplace, the burst limit is slightly different - 110 requests per 10 seconds per installing account.

Understanding these limits is essential for ensuring your integrations run smoothly and without interruptions.

How Rate Limits Affect Your Integrations

These rate limits can directly impact the reliability of your integrations. If you exceed them, you'll encounter disruptions, such as failed requests that prevent data synchronization or halt automated workflows. For example, unhandled HTTP 429 errors can result in missed updates, like unsynced contact changes, form submissions, or deal modifications.

For apps listed in the HubSpot Marketplace, maintaining error responses below 5% of total daily requests is a requirement to retain certification. Repeatedly hitting rate limits could jeopardize your app's eligibility. Additionally, requesting too much data - such as unoptimized CRM Search queries or excessive property requests - can lead to 502 or 504 Gateway Timeout errors.

Another issue to watch out for is the "thundering herd" effect. This happens when multiple threads retry failed requests simultaneously, overwhelming the system with retries and causing even more 429 errors. This cascading effect makes recovery slower and more difficult.

Being aware of these challenges helps you design integrations that are resilient and efficient.

Building Your Custom API Integration

Selecting Your Authentication Method

When creating a custom API integration with HubSpot, you’ll need to choose between two authentication methods: OAuth 2.0 and Private App Tokens. Each serves different purposes depending on your integration’s scope.

OAuth 2.0 is the go-to option for integrations involving multiple HubSpot accounts or if you plan to list your app in the HubSpot Marketplace. It uses a three-token flow: authorization codes, short-lived access tokens (which expire after 30 minutes), and long-term refresh tokens. While this method offers higher security with its short-lived credentials, it does require a backend to handle the token exchange process, making setup more complex.

Private App Tokens, on the other hand, are ideal for single-account integrations. These static tokens are easier to implement since they can be copied directly from your HubSpot settings. They don’t expire, simplifying token management for smaller or internal projects.

"The gap between a working integration and a production-ready one usually comes down to how well you handle tokens." - HubSpot Developer Blog

Proper token management is non-negotiable. Never store tokens in plain text - use encrypted databases with AES-256 encryption or tools like AWS Secrets Manager or HashiCorp Vault. HubSpot also actively scans GitHub repositories for exposed tokens and will automatically deactivate any compromised private app tokens or developer API keys. For OAuth integrations, ensure you refresh access tokens at least 5 minutes before expiration to prevent failed API calls during critical operations.

Testing API Endpoints First

Before rolling out your integration, it’s crucial to test the API thoroughly to ensure smooth performance and adherence to rate limits. HubSpot provides tools like official Postman collections and SDKs to help you inspect HTTP response headers and monitor API behavior.

Pay attention to specific response headers during testing:

  • X-HubSpot-RateLimit-Daily-Remaining: Tracks how many requests you can make for the day.
  • X-HubSpot-RateLimit-Remaining: Indicates the remaining requests in the current 10-second burst window.

Optimize your requests by experimenting with limit parameters for pagination. For example, if a request for 100 records times out with a 504 error, try reducing the limit to 50 or 25 until you find the right balance. To avoid unnecessary delays, only request the properties you actually need in the properties array, as large datasets can slow down processing and cause timeouts.

Simulate a 429 error in a controlled sandbox environment to verify that your retry logic works as expected. Testing this ensures your integration can handle HubSpot’s rate constraints without interruptions. Keep in mind that some APIs, like the CRM Search API, have stricter limits (e.g., 5 requests per second), which may require additional testing if default client libraries don’t account for these restrictions.

For ongoing monitoring, use the Monitoring > API call usage dashboard in your HubSpot account. This provides a detailed view of logs and usage metrics across all connected apps.

How to Manage HubSpot API Rate Limits

Tracking Your Rate Limit Usage

HubSpot offers several ways to keep an eye on your API usage. Every API response (except those from the CRM Search API) includes headers like "X-HubSpot-RateLimit-Daily-Remaining", which shows how many calls you have left in your 24-hour quota. To get a broader view, head to Development > API call usage in your HubSpot account. If you're using public or legacy apps, you can dive into detailed logs under Monitoring > Logs. There's also a dedicated API endpoint to check your call count for the current day.

If you hit a 429 error (indicating you've exceeded a limit), the JSON response will include a "policyName" field to clarify whether it's the daily or secondly limit. Keep in mind, the daily limit resets at midnight based on your account's time zone. By regularly monitoring your usage, you can avoid unexpected throttling and ensure your workflows run smoothly.

Batching Your API Requests

Batching is a game-changer for minimizing API calls. HubSpot's batch endpoints let you process up to 100 records in a single call, which can significantly cut down your usage. For example, if you're dealing with complex queries involving nested data (like pulling Company → Contacts → Tasks), using GraphQL can consolidate what might have been thousands of REST API calls into just one.

This approach is especially useful when syncing data, such as form submissions from tools like Reform to HubSpot. By batching, you can transfer data efficiently without burning through your quota. In fact, batching can reduce your API call volume by up to 60%, and combining it with effective caching can shrink your total requests by as much as 75%.

Adding Retry Logic and Exponential Backoff

When you hit a 429 error, don't just retry immediately. Instead, use exponential backoff, which means increasing the wait time between retries after each failure, up to a defined limit. Adding jitter (a random delay of about ±500 milliseconds) can help avoid multiple retries happening simultaneously.

"A 429 from HubSpot normally just means you've hit the documented limits on the API... Best practice is to add exponential backoff and queuing so that transient 429s don't break your app."

For developers working in Node.js, the bottleneck npm package is a handy tool - it can automatically handle request rates and manage 429 errors. Using exponential backoff can cut API error rates by over 50%. Plus, if you're aiming for HubSpot Marketplace certification, keeping error responses below 5% of your total daily requests is a must.

Scaling Your HubSpot API Integration

Once you've implemented batching, caching, and exponential backoff, you might find that these optimizations aren't enough for your growing needs. When that happens, it’s time to look at scaling your integration. This could mean upgrading your HubSpot plan or exploring alternative ways to transfer data.

Upgrading Your HubSpot Plan for Higher Limits

Start by reviewing your API usage under Development > Monitoring > API call usage. This will help you determine if your consumption is nearing burst or daily limits. You can also check API response headers for signs of low daily quotas.

If you’re noticing frequent 429 Too Many Requests errors with the policy name DAILY, it’s a sign you may need a higher subscription tier or an additional capacity pack. However, before committing to an upgrade, make sure you’ve optimized your integration by using batching (up to 100 records per call), caching, and webhooks to reduce unnecessary API calls. For example, using multi-step form design can help you collect data more efficiently before it ever hits your API.

For those needing more capacity, Enterprise subscriptions allow up to 1,000,000 daily requests - 60% more than the Professional plan. Additionally, you can purchase the API Limit Increase add-on, which provides an extra 1,000,000 daily requests. You can buy up to two of these add-ons, giving you a maximum of 2,000,000 additional requests per day. To explore this option, visit the HubSpot Product & Services Catalog and look for the "API Limit Increase" add-on.

Using Webhooks Instead of Polling

Polling generates frequent API requests, which can quickly exhaust your limits. Webhooks, on the other hand, push data to your system only when specific events occur. This method not only conserves API calls but also improves the overall efficiency of your integration. For those with a Marketing Enterprise subscription, webhook calls triggered via workflows don’t count toward your API rate limit. This makes webhooks an essential tool for high-volume integrations.

You can configure webhooks in workflows to trigger updates when specific actions occur, like changes to contact records. Each app can support up to 1,000 webhook subscriptions, which should accommodate even the most complex scaling needs. For enterprise-level setups, consider implementing a Queue/Worker architecture. This allows you to process incoming webhook data asynchronously, ensuring your system remains resilient under heavy loads. Additionally, HubSpot retries failed webhooks at increasing intervals for up to three days, giving you time to resolve any issues.

FAQs

How can I tell if I’m hitting burst limits or daily limits?

When working with HubSpot's API, you can check the response headers to monitor your remaining quota for each limit. These headers give you a clear picture of whether you're nearing or exceeding either the burst rate or daily rate limits. Keeping an eye on these details helps you manage your API usage effectively.

What’s the best way to queue API calls so I don’t get 429s?

To steer clear of 429 errors, try using exponential backoff with retries. This means gradually increasing the wait time after each failed request, giving the API a chance to recover without being overwhelmed.

You can also optimize your requests by leveraging batch APIs and implementing proper pagination. This approach reduces the number of individual calls you make, helping you stay within rate limits.

For larger-scale integrations, consider setting up a queue or worker system. This allows you to handle API calls asynchronously, giving you more control over the pace of requests and reducing the likelihood of hitting rate limits.

When should I switch from polling to webhooks in HubSpot?

Webhooks in HubSpot are ideal when you need real-time updates on changes to your data, such as contact or deal updates. Unlike polling, which repeatedly requests data and can lead to API limits being consumed or throttling errors, webhooks are event-driven. This means they automatically send notifications whenever specific events occur. By using webhooks, you not only get instant updates but also significantly reduce API usage, making it easier to stay within rate limits.
